訓(xùn)練簡介
TestComplete以其完整全面的功能、低廉的價格成為主流自動化測試工具QTP的強(qiáng)有力競爭對手,目前正被越來越多的企業(yè)所采用。但是國內(nèi)這方面的學(xué)習(xí)資料和培訓(xùn)課程都比較匱乏,TIB自動化測試工作室專家總結(jié)多年TestComplete使用經(jīng)驗(yàn),結(jié)合企業(yè)培訓(xùn)需求,整合多個TestComplete企業(yè)培訓(xùn)課程設(shè)計(jì)材料,推出TestComplete自動化測試實(shí)戰(zhàn)訓(xùn)練課程,涵蓋TestComplete工具基礎(chǔ)使用、腳本語言基礎(chǔ)、腳本設(shè)計(jì)、對象識別、框架設(shè)計(jì)等方面的內(nèi)容。
訓(xùn)練大綱
1、 TestComplete腳本編程基礎(chǔ)
介紹TestComplete
TestComplete支持的腳本語言
VBScript基本語法
VBScript常用函數(shù)
VBScript常用對象
腳本編程練習(xí)
2、TestComplete工具基礎(chǔ)使用
創(chuàng)建ProjectSuite、Project
Object Browser的使用
錄制腳本,錄制Keyword Test,回放腳本、查看回放日志
從Keyword Test轉(zhuǎn)換到Script Test
CheckPoint、Stores、TestedApps
3、TestComplete工具高級使用
腳本調(diào)試
等待對象的出現(xiàn),Delay、Exists、WaitAliasChild
Log對象的使用
TestCompelte內(nèi)建對象和函數(shù)的使用(Desktop、aqEnvironment、aqString、aqConvert)
NameMapping、Aliases、動態(tài)控件名問題
多語言版本測試
MSAA、UI Automation
CLR Bridge、調(diào)用DLL
腳本編寫技巧(Keys Vs. Set、滾動條問題、ClickButton vs.Click)
4、對象識別技術(shù)
Open Application
Object Mapping
WPF控件識別、復(fù)雜控件(Composite Controls)、第三方控件問題
Telerik、Infragistics 案例分析+演練
5、對象動態(tài)查找
WaitProcess、WaitWPFObject
Child、WaitChild、WaitProperty
Find、FindChild、FindAll、FindAllChildren
同名窗口或控件的問題
查找的技巧
案例分析+演練
6、自動化測試腳本設(shè)計(jì)*實(shí)踐
模塊化結(jié)構(gòu)、ProjectSuite、Project、Unit
函數(shù)庫結(jié)構(gòu)、全局變量、Script Extension的開發(fā)
數(shù)據(jù)驅(qū)動、DDT、數(shù)據(jù)表設(shè)計(jì)、ADO連接數(shù)據(jù)源
關(guān)鍵字驅(qū)動
腳本異常處理、非預(yù)期窗口的處理、Event Handling(介紹測試中常用的Event)
腳本編寫規(guī)范(腳本語言的選擇、腳本注釋、命名規(guī)范)
案例分析+演練
7、自動化測試框架搭建
Connected Application、如何在VS2010中使用TC腳本
命令行執(zhí)行、COM方式調(diào)用
與持續(xù)集成框架整合
與NCover整合度量測試覆蓋率
測試環(huán)境自動化
自動化測試項(xiàng)目問題分析解決
問題分析、討論、自動化測試經(jīng)驗(yàn)分享
訓(xùn)練時間:2天(10月29日、10月30日)
報名方法:
請?zhí)顚懸韵马?xiàng)目,發(fā)郵件到quicktest#qq.com(請把#改為@),我們將盡快告訴您是否還有座位為您預(yù)留,以及其他后續(xù)細(xì)節(jié)。
所在單位名稱:
姓名:
*/職務(wù):
通訊地址及郵編:
電話:
手機(jī):
E-mail:
MSN/QQ:
* 名額有限,先到先得,按聽課證號順序入座,報滿則停止。